How they compare
Mexico currently reports 691,000 m3 against 571,596 m3 in Bosnia and Herzegovina, a difference of 119,404 m3.
That makes Mexico's figure about 1.2 times Bosnia and Herzegovina's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 27 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Mexico ahead.
Bosnia and Herzegovina ranks 46th and Mexico ranks 44th of 95 countries.
Mexico has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bosnia and Herzegovina | Mexico |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 130,000 m3 | 1.22 million m3 | 1.09 million m3 | Mexico |
| 2000s | 201,689 m3 | 927,800 m3 | 726,111 m3 | Mexico |
| 2010s | 625,801 m3 | 632,600 m3 | 6,799 m3 | Mexico |
| 2020s | 556,680 m3 | 733,200 m3 | 176,520 m3 | Mexico |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
